Abstract

An environ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es is provided, which uses recycled used shoes as a primary constituent of the raw material thereof, which used shoes, after being processed to remove metal accessories mounted inside and outside the shoes, are subjected to shredding pulverization by a shredding pulverization machine and are then subjected to application steam for high temperature heating for deodorization and drying to form tiny pieces of recycled raw material, which can be used as a raw material for making shoe soles. This raw material is further mixed with a base rubber and a suitable amount of curing additives, activation prompting agents, and filling agents to form a moldable shoe sole raw material, which is put into a mold and heated and pressurized for curing and shaping, so as to realize total recycling of complete used shoes for pollution-free manufacturing of shoe soles.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. An environ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es, the shoe sole being manufactured by steps of mixing and stirring raw materials, molding and shaping, and trimming, characterized in that the raw material is comprised of a primary constituent of recycled shoes, which, after being subjected to removal of metal accessories, is disposed in a shredding pulverization machine for pulverization so that all shaped parts of complete shoes are pulverized and subjected to sufficient stirring through helical means to for tiny pieces of a size of 5 mmF, followed by deodorization and drying through high temperature steam and hot air cleaning and eliminating odors of the recycled shoes to thereby realize full shoe recycling for processing to form pulverized and uniformly-mixed environmental-protection shoe sole raw material. 
     
     
         2 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 1 , wherein the high temperature deodorization comprises feeding the material into an enclosed tunnel-like conveying device and subjecting the material to high temperature steam deodorization at a temperature approximately or above 120° C. 
     
     
         3 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 1 , wherein the shredding pulverization is performed through an arrangement comprising a material hopper having a bottom coupled to a feeding tank inside which parallel arranged rotating helical cutters are provided for rotating in different direction at high speeds for shredding the recycled shoes for pulverization as broken tiny pieces. 
     
     
         4 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 3 , wherein the helical cutters are arranged in parallel and are rotatable at different high speeds. 
     
     
         5 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 3 , wherein the parallel arranged helical cutters are rotated at speeds of which a ratio is 1:2.4. 
     
     
         6 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 4 , wherein the parallel arranged helical cutters are rotated at speeds of which a ratio is 1:2.4. 
     
     
         7 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according  claim 1 , wherein the pulverized recycled shoes take an amount of 5-90% of the shoe sole raw material. 
     
     
         8 . An environ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es, the shoe sole being manufactured by mixing and stirring raw materials, molding and shaping, and trimming, characterized in that recycled shoes are used as a raw material, which takes an amount of 5-90% of shoe sole material and is further mixed with a suitable amount of a base rubber in an amount of 5-90% and further added with suitable amounts of 5-10% of additives, followed by mechanically and uniformly mixed and stirred, processed by a planar rolling device to be rolled to form sheet-like environmental-protection shoe sole material for being ready to cut and positioned in a mold for molding by being heating and pressurized for curing and shaping to thereby form a shoe sole of environmental-protection material. 
     
     
         9 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 8 , wherein the sheet-like shoe sole material that is formed by mixing and stirring the raw material obtained from pulverization of recycled shoes is of a thickness of 1-50 mm. 
     
     
         10 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 1 , wherein in mixing and stirring of the shoe sole sheet material, the material is added with filling agents including Kaolin, calcium carbonate, and glass powder to offer rigid properties of the sheet material. 
     
     
         11 . The environmental-protection shoe sole made of complete recycled shoes according to  claim 10 , wherein the filling agents are of an amount of 5-10% of the stirred material.
